Etymology 1

[edit]

Feminized version of company (mate, partner).

Noun

[edit]

companya f (plural companyes)

  1. female partner

Etymology 2

[edit]

Inherited from Vulgar Latin *compānia, a collective noun based on Late Latin compāniō (comrade).

Noun

[edit]

companya f (plural companyes)

  1. society, group of people
